Ok there is going to be a TV programme in the UK where one person will be selected via a series of fitness tests and kark, single seater and tin top races.
The prize is a drive in the Thoroughbread GP championship. It is the first programme of its sort although the Big Time in 1979 featuring Tim lee Davey saw him going Formula Ford racing and he was able to graduate through F3 and Group C.
